How did you tie that inspiration in to what you choose for your bridesmaid dresses/bridal gown?
The color scheme was very neutral so it was easy to pick based on that. one of the photos that inspired me actually had similar colored bridesmaid dresses and i loved the way they looked. once i showed Stacey the picture she helped me find the perfect options.

What did you choose?
What color?
Jenny Yoo – Barley, Dessy – Bailey – they happened to be the exact same material and color and matched perfectly to the point that you would never know that half the girls were wearing different brands!

Tips for brides when selecting their BM dresses? Bridal Gowns?
Try to think about what your bridesmaids will be excited to wear and feel beautiful in – the happier everyone else is the better you’ll feel on that day too!
